New £31m Hillingdon leisure centre opens

Hillingdon Council has announced the opening of a new £31m leisure centre to local residents in Uxbridge, west London - a month ahead of the venue's official opening.

The new Hillingdon Sports and Leisure Complex, which boasts the first Olympic-sized swimming pool to open in London for 40 years, is due to be officially opened by London mayor Boris Johnson on 23 March. Facilities at the centre include a 400sq m (4,306sq ft) cv and static weights area, a 52sq m (560sq ft) spin studio and a 162sq m (1,744sq ft) dance studio, as well as a 105sq m (1,130sq ft) free weights area. Equipment has been supplied by Matrix.

A multi-use sports hall, shallow pools and a sauna and steamroom, are also among the centre's facilities as well as classrooms for training, a café and a crèche. The site's 1930s open-air swimming pool, grandstands, cascades and entrance building have also undergone a full refurbishment as part of the development.

Hillingdon Council has contributed £26m towards the new complex, in addition to more than £2m from the London Development Agency and £1.5m from Sport England. The Heritage Lottery Fund also provided £1m towards the refurbishment of the Grade II-listed open-air pool. Ray Puddifoot, leader of Hillingdon Council, said: "We recognise that quality of life is important to our residents and this complex provides top class facilities that people of all ages and abilities will be able to enjoy.

"Along with the new Botwell Green Sports centre that will be opening in Hayes in a few months time, we really will have some of the best sports provision around and a legacy for future generations." Non-residents will be able to sign up for membership of the centre now, which will become active after the venue's official March opening.
